I rate the 4person room with balcony.
Pro:
The place ist nice and quiet, feels luxurious, good bedsheets, nice sunset view. Some piano (tv) sound comes from the lobby. Nice Ambiente. Good value for the price. This is not the city center, you take a grab to go somewhere, place can be found as ”d house” on Google maps easily.
Many power outlets, space, tables and some chairs and 2 mirrors in the room. The bedsheets are thick, only 2 sheets for 4 persons but I guess it's for couples.
Con:
The indoor slippers hurt my feet with every step, there are many steps to level -2. Cannot take them off because the floor is cold.
When going to toilet or shower, you must bring the toiletpaper, towel, shampoo clothes etc from your room, lock your room, bring your keys, ...
*** you need an orgachart and checklist just for taking a poop.
Light cannot be switched from bed, and when entering the room you must first reach behind the door.
After 8pm you need to fiddle a bit to open the gate.
No wifi information stored in the app or in the room.

AAgnes_XNo need to worry about the review and image description being exactly the same, just look at the pictures to decide! The location is excellent, apart from one steep hill. It's a 15-minute walk to the largest bus station/gas station in the area, and the Da Lat cable car is nearby. The bedding is very comfortable, and they change it daily. All the staff are incredibly friendly and welcoming. In contrast, the Trip.com customer service was unhelpful and spoke nonsense; they didn't even bother to ask my question but just arbitrarily answered on behalf of the hotel that they couldn't receive emails, even though the hotel was more than happy to help. You can rent motorbikes directly from the hotel. We rode for three days and only spent 60,000 VND on gas – fantastic value for money! There are some small family restaurants nearby with decent food, and most importantly, they're very cheap, offering a glimpse into local life. The swimming pool is open 24 hours. However, Da Lat is simply too cold; even swimming in the middle of the day was freezing. When the staff heard I wanted to use the pool, a young man immediately went to clean it. In the evening, the hotel received a call from our bus pick-up and even transferred the call and helped us with our luggage. Overall, I'm extremely satisfied; for this price, it's incredible value for money. The only issue is that they might be using a very small electric water heater, as the water turns cold in less than 10 minutes.
